What is the difference between digital printing and transfer printing?

From the perspective of dyes (paint, reactive, dispersion), pigment printing and dye printing can be distinguished by comparing the hardness difference between the printed and unprinted parts on the same fabric. The paint-printed area feels a little harder and maybe a little thicker than the unprinted area. White paint is also used for printing, this factor should not be ignored. Dye printing is when the feel of the printed area and the unprinted area is very small.


The printing process design is mainly based on the characteristics of the pattern and the requirements of the guests. First of all, it is necessary to review the pattern, which is determined in combination with factors such as fabric fibers, printing methods, dye selection and equipment. Be sure to find out the customer's requirements for fabrics, polyester, cotton or blended and other fabrics. Secondly, find out the selection of printing dyes by the guests. Generally, direct dyes, reactive dyes or coatings are used for cotton printing, disperse dyes for polyester, and coatings are also useful, but reactive dyes cannot be used.


The digital ones can be printed on paper and then transferred to the cloth, while the pure digital ones cannot generally be printed on a piece of cloth. The transfer is in large batches and can print a piece of cloth with a width of 1.5 to 3.0 meters. As for the distinction, you can Depending on the critical line of flower position and the number of colors, more than 8 transfers are not common, so if there are many colors and various levels, there is a great possibility of transfer. The price of the transfer is different according to the base fabric, which is already 2-4 yuan, and the digital is much more expensive.
